What is Reseller Hosting?

Reseller Hosting is a type of web hosting where the account owner has the ability to use their assigned hard drive space and bandwidth to host websites on behalf of third parties. The reseller purchases the host's services on a wholesale basis and then sells them to customers, possibly for a profit.

How Reseller Hosting Works

1. Purchase a Reseller Hosting Plan: The first step is to buy a reseller hosting package from a reputable hosting company. These packages vary in terms of storage, bandwidth, and other features, so you'll want to choose a plan that suits your anticipated needs.

2. Set Up Your Hosting Plans: Most reseller hosting packages come with a control panel that allows you to divide up your purchased resources into individual packages. You can customize these packages to cater to different needs.

3. Sell Hosting Packages: With your hosting plans in place, you can now sell to your own clients. Your clients will typically have access to their own control panel without any indication that you're effectively reselling.

4. Provide Customer Support: As a reseller, you'll usually be the first point of contact for your clients.

Reseller Hosting vs Other Types of Hosting

Reseller hosting differs from other types of hosting in significant ways. For instance, shared hosting is where many sites share the same server resources. This is the cheapest option and best for small websites with low traffic. Dedicated hosting provides a whole server for one website which is ideal for large businesses and high-traffic websites as it provides greater flexibility and resources. VPS hosting is the middle ground, offering a partition of the server for one website.

But in reseller hosting, you're allowed to resell your server resources, creating and managing multiple accounts like a hosting provider.

How to Start Reseller Hosting Business

1. Find a Suitable Hosting Company: Look for a hosting company that offers reseller hosting packages.

2. Purchase a Reseller Package: Choose a package that meets your resource demands with a balanced price.

3. Understand Your Market: Identify the types of websites and businesses you want to target.

4. Set Up and Configure Your Plan: Design pricing and plans around your market's needs and your resources.

5. Start Selling: Market your services and start selling.

6. Provide Customer Support: Offer stellar customer service to retain your existing customers and attract new ones.
